Plaque in memory of Leopold Tyrmand at 6 Konopnickiej Street in [[Warsaw]], where he lived from 1946 to 1955 Leopold Tyrmand (May 16, 1920 – March 19, 1985) was a Polish novelist, writer, and editor. Tyrmand emigrated from Poland to the United States in 1966 and five years later married an American, Mary Ellen Fox. He served as editor of an anti-communist monthly ''Chronicles of Culture'' with John A. Howard. Tyrmand died of a heart attack at the age of 64 in Florida. Provided by Wikipedia
